Classes saved by CIT brings music to students’ ears
There had been fears that classes for first and second-level students — the lifeblood of CSM — would bear the brunt of proposed cutbacks across Cork Institute of Technology’s constituent schools.
But the institute’s governing body confirmed last night that it has directed that the institute maintain the number of students admitted to the first level programmes this year.
